Enyimba's Udoh eyes another 'brilliant' outing vs. Shooting Stars

Enyimba’s skipper, Mfon Udoh is eyeing a repeat of their midweek's heroics when they face Shooting Stars on Sunday in another important league clash.

The Aba giants staged a comeback against Lobi Stars on Wednesday to collect maximum points. And are looking for another 'brilliant performance' when they trade tackles with the Oluyole Warriors who have remained unbeaten in their last four matches.

“The result against Lobi Stars has been confined to the history books now but we can’t forget about the brilliant performance of everyone on the pitch and those supporting us from the bench and on the stands. It was a day we unitedly said we won’t lose the game and God heard our prayers. The performance against Lobi has now become a yardstick for us to measure what we must do and achieve in our remaining matches,” Udoh told Goal.

“Shooting Stars are a tough side considering their results recently. We must urge ourselves on to the pitch on Sunday and never believe the game has been won or lost until the match officials end the game. If we are determined just like we did in the face of defeat against Lobi, we can achieve a good result in Ibadan in similar way too.”
